.exe 和 .msi 安装程序无法在 Windows 10 OS 上运行

.exe and .msi installers does not runs on Windows 10 OS

我试图在 Windows 10 Pro 64 位 OS PC 上安装 Node.js node-v14.15.1-x64,但后来我发现问题出现在任何 .exe.msi

如果我尝试 运行 安装程序 with/without 管理员,我的屏幕上只有无尽的蓝色加载圆圈图标,任务管理器中没有任何错误报告或进程:

带有光标箭头的挂起图标不会消失,即使我会等待一个小时,要停止它,我必须重新启动计算机

我遵循了 Stein Åsmul 的回答,但我不得不保留未标记的答案,因为它似乎还没有任何帮助:

  1. 我已经重新下载了安装介质,但现在我发现所有安装程序都会出现这种情况。

  2. 我试过关闭 Windows Defender 防火墙和安全防病毒软件。

  3. C:\WINDOWS\system32>sfc /scannow Windows 资源保护未发现任何完整性违规。

  4. HKEY_CLASSES_ROOT/.exe值为exefileexefile folder值为Application,我尝试用"%1"%*

  5. H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ion中在ProgrmFilesDir中的值为C:\Program Files,在ProgramFiles Dir (x86)中的值为C:\Program Files (x86)

  6. 尝试 C:\WINDOWS\system32>assoc .exe=exefile 这里也出了问题,因为 OS 冻结,我被迫重新启动

  7. C:\WINDOWS\system32>msiexec.exe /i :\Users\User\Desktop\New folder (1)\pycharm-community-2020.2.3.exe /L*v C:\Your.log opens Windows Installers,里面描述了Display, Install, Restart and Logging Options,但是我不太确定,怎么用,自己去了解下本期

解法:

删除 AVScanner.ini 表单后 C:\ 目录问题消失,安装工作正常

我还要注意,我会用 Stein Åsmul 标记答案,因为我发现它在类似的可能情况下很有用,即使在这种特殊情况下它不是解决方案

任何建议、指南或示例都会有所帮助

总体:有截图吗?这听起来像是 Windows Smartscreen 问题?

以下是一些通用的 setup.exe 调试建议:

  • Long setup.exe problem list.

具体建议: 1)先重新下载安装介质所有的。 2) 然后重新启动并禁用防病毒扫描程序并尝试安装。 3) 您还应该 并查看日志以寻找线索。 4) 尝试以不同的管理员用户身份安装。 5) 最后在虚拟机或其他机器上测试以验证安装文件的完整性。

快速记录:

msiexec.exe /i C:\Path\Your.msi /L*v C:\Your.log

  • General WiX and setup links(部分:"Generic Tricks? - Consumer issues"
  • Smartscreen issues